The Motive: Ageing Pores and skin

"As we age, it's fully regular for our hair, together with eyebrows and lashes, to skinny," says Audrianna Mora, the International Training Supervisor of RevitaLash Cosmetics. Over time, pores and skin loses its elasticity, inflicting hair follicles to develop into brittle and fall out. A few of these follicles might cease producing hair altogether, which is when eyebrows start to recede and seem patchy. Thinning arches may also be a facet impact of itchy pores and skin situations akin to psoriasis and eczema, which may not directly trigger hair loss when an infected forehead space is scratched too often.

The Motive: Hormonal Adjustments

Adjustments in hormones throughout menopause may also contribute to hair loss and thinning brows. As girls undergo this alteration, ranges of sure hormones like ​prostaglandin, estrogen, and progesterone start decline; strands then turns into weak and falls out. This shift in hormones is often one of many most important causes of hair loss in girls over 40.

The Motive: Dietary Deficiencies

Research present that there could also be a hyperlink between dietary deficiencies and hair loss. Low ranges of iron, zinc, and protein could also be accountable for thinning brows and sure medical situations like anemia. The Answer: Microblading

Microblading, a semi-permanent type of forehead tattooing, makes use of tiny needles to deposit pigment into the pores and skin—creating the looks of fuller arches. Whereas it’d sound scary (and harsh), microblading isn't as practically as painful as getting a tattoo and often lasts between one to 3 years; it additionally yields a pure consequence, as long as you flip to a licensed skilled for the remedy.
